How to add signature in hotmail 2012
A blast from the past! Hotmail 2012 is an older version of the email service, but I'll guide you through the process of adding a signature to your Hotmail account.
Method 1: Using the Hotmail Web Interface
- Log in to your Hotmail account.
- Click on the gear icon () in the top right corner of the page.
- Select "More Mail Settings" from the dropdown menu.
- Scroll down to the "Compose" section.
- Click on "Signature" and then click on "Edit".
- In the "Signature" field, type in your desired signature text.
- You can also add HTML code to your signature by clicking on the "Rich Text" button.
- Click "Save" to save your changes.
